Question:
I have 2001 Toyota 4Runner Limited Is this part #90195 fit to my car?
asked by: Rolando
Expert Reply:
The Tekonsha Prodigy P3 Trailer Brake Controller # 90195 will work on your 2001 Toyota 4Runner. Since your 4Runner did not come installed with a factory 7-way connector you will need one to complete the install.
If you do not have a 4-way connector installed on your vehicle I recommend the Tekonsha T-One 4-way connector # 118341 which will plug in to the factory harness of your 4Runner and will only require you to run a power wire to the battery of your vehicle to keep your factory harness from being overloaded.
Next you will need to install the Universal Installation Kit for Trailer Brake Controller # ETBC7 which will plug into your 4-way connector, and give you the additional wires needed to use the Tekonsha Prodigy P3 # 90195. You will need to install the white wire from the # ETBC7 to your vehicles frame, and run the blue wire inside of the cab of your 4Runner to plug in to your trailer brake controller harness.
You can now mount the Tekonsha Prodigy P3 # 90195 and connect the blue wire from the controller harness to the blue wire from your # ETBC7. Connect the white wire from your controller harness to the negative post of your battery. The black wire from your controller harness needs to go to the positive post of your battery with a 20-amp circuit breaker installed that is included with the # ETBC7. Using a circuit tester like # PTW2993 you will need to find the wire coming from your stop light switch on the back of your brake pedal that only has power when the brake pedal is pressed, tap into it and connect it to the red wire from your controller harness.
